Gather and Present Evidence Effectively
After a bus accident, the chaos can be overwhelming, but bus injury attorneys emphasize that gathering evidence is crucial for your recovery. Here are best practices to ensure that you compile a strong case:
- Document the Scene: Promptly after the incident, if safe to do so, take photographs of the scene, including the bus, other vehicles involved, road conditions, and any visible injuries. This visual evidence can be crucial in establishing the circumstances of the incident.
- Collect Witness Information: Gather contact details from witnesses who can corroborate your account of the incident. Eyewitness testimony is vital, as it provides objective accounts that can significantly strengthen your claim.
- Obtain Medical Records: Keep detailed records of all medical treatments related to your injuries, including hospital visits, prescriptions, and rehabilitation sessions. Medical documentation is essential for proving the extent of your injuries and the associated costs.
- Accident Reports: Request a copy of the police report, as it often contains important details about the accident, including witness statements and the officer's assessment of fault. This report serves as an official record that can support your case with bus injury attorneys.
- Insurance Information: Collect information about the bus company's insurance policy, including coverage limits. Understanding the insurance landscape can help in negotiations and ensure that you pursue the appropriate compensation.
- Organize Evidence: Create a comprehensive file that includes all collected evidence, organized chronologically. This will facilitate easier access for your attorney and streamline the claims process.

Know the Legal Process and Timelines
After a bus accident, the road ahead can seem daunting and filled with uncertainty. Here are key steps and timelines to help you navigate this challenging journey:
- Stay at the Scene: If you can, remain at the accident site and ensure your safety by moving to a secure location. Leaving the scene can lead to serious legal consequences, adding to your stress.

- Filing a Claim: In New York, you have a limited window of three years to file a personal injury lawsuit, which can feel like a ticking clock when you're already dealing with so much. However, claims against public entities like the MTA require a Notice of Claim to be filed within 90 days, emphasizing the urgency of your actions.
- Investigation Phase: After hiring a lawyer, they will start examining the incident, collecting evidence, and consulting with specialists if needed. This phase can take several weeks to months, depending on the complexity of the case. Documenting the accident scene by taking pictures of vehicle damage and gathering information from all parties involved is critical for your claim.
- Negotiation: Following the evidence gathering, your lawyer will negotiate with the insurance company. Negotiations can feel like a waiting game, and it’s important to remember that your feelings matter during this process. Without the assistance of bus injury attorneys, you may face lowball offers from insurers, which can significantly impact your compensation.
- Litigation: If a fair settlement cannot be reached, your attorney may recommend filing a lawsuit. This involves additional timelines, including discovery, pre-trial motions, and potentially a trial date.
- Settlement or Trial: Most disputes resolve before reaching trial, but if your matter advances to trial, be ready for a lengthy process. Trials can take days to weeks, depending on the complexity of the case and the number of witnesses involved. On average, bus accident litigation in NYC typically spans 6 to 18 months for most settlements.
